最新实例
Sybase 15.7 for Linux 6中检查逻辑读高的SPID的语句分析
通过以下语句检查逻辑读较多的SPID:
select SPID, KPID, BatchID, ContextID, DBID, ProcedureID, StartTime, ElapsedTime = datediff(ss, StartTime, max(EndTime)), CPUTime = sum(CpuTime), LogicalReads = sum(LogicalReads), PagesModified = sum(PagesModified)
from master..monSysStatement
group by SPID, KPID, BatchID, ContextID, DBID, ProcedureID, StartTime
having datediff(ss, StartTime, max(EndTime)) > 0
and sum(LogicalReads) > 0
order by 7
在此查询语句中,通过计算每个会话(SPID)的CPU时间和逻辑读数,可以筛选出那些在逻辑读方面负载较高的会话,以优化数据库性能。
Sybase
0
2024-10-28
PowerBuilder 扩展函数集全面解读
PowerBuilder 扩展函数集详解
PowerBuilder(PB)是一款强大的客户端/服务器应用程序开发工具,以其易用性、数据窗口组件和面向对象编程特性深受开发者青睐。尽管 PB 自带丰富的内置函数,但在某些复杂场景下,PowerBuilder 扩展函数集可提供更强的功能支持。扩展函数集包括以下主要功能:
系统级操作:如文件和目录管理,支持创建、删除、复制、移动文件和目录及获取文件信息,弥补 PB 标准库的不足。
网络通信:包括 HTTP 请求、FTP 操作、TCP/IP 通信等,帮助 PB 应用与远程服务器高效交互。
加密解密:通过 API 或自定义 C 函数实现数据加密和解密,增强应用安全性。
日期时间处理:提供复杂的时间计算、格式化和比较功能,超越 PB 内置的日期时间处理。
字符串操作:扩展字符串处理功能,如正则表达式匹配、XML 解析和 JSON 操作,简化复杂代码编写。
性能优化:包括内存管理和多线程操作,提升应用运行效率。
数据库操作:支持高级查询和数据处理,如批量插入和复杂 SQL 构造,扩展数据窗口的能力。
图形图像处理:实现图片读取、修改、保存功能,甚至包含基本图像识别。
系统信息获取:方便获取硬件信息、操作系统版本和网络状态,有助于调试和监控。
错误处理和日志记录:改进的错误处理和日志记录机制,便于程序问题追踪与修复。
导入 exfuns.pbl PowerBuilder 库文件即可将这些扩展函数应用到 PB 项目中,通过实例化用户对象调用相关功能。
Sybase
0
2024-10-28
PowerDesigner 15.1中文操作手册及实践教程
PowerDesigner 15.1 是一款强大的数据建模工具,广泛应用于企业级数据库设计、分析和规划。以下为中文使用手册的详细内容,帮助用户更好地理解和掌握PowerDesigner的主要功能:
1. 安装与启动
在安装PowerDesigner 15.1时,按照安装向导步骤确保安装所有必要组件。启动后,界面简洁直观,提供多种模型创建选项,方便用户操作。
2. 概念数据模型(CDM)
CDM主要用于描述业务实体和关系的抽象结构,不依赖于具体的数据库管理系统。用户可以创建实体、定义属性并设置实体关系,帮助理解业务需求和数据结构。
3. 物理数据模型(PDM)
PDM是对CDM的具体实现,包含DBMS语法和特性。用户可将CDM转换为PDM,并对表、字段、键、索引进行调整,以适应目标数据库。
4. 逆向工程
PowerDesigner支持从现有数据库生成PDM功能,方便用户理解已有系统或整合数据源。
5. 数据流图(DFD)与业务流程模型
不仅限于数据库设计,PowerDesigner还支持数据流图与业务流程模型,展示数据流动和优化工作流程。
6. 报表和图表生成
手册中详细介绍了如何生成报表和图表,如ER图、关系图、状态转移图等,便于设计审查和方案交流。
7. 版本控制与团队协作
集成的版本控制系统支持团队成员协同编辑,避免冲突,支持CVS和SVN。
8. 代码生成与数据库脚本
完成模型设计后,PowerDesigner可自动生成数据库脚本和代码片段,加速开发进度。
9. 性能分析
通过物理设计的性能分析功能,用户可以优化模型表现,确保在实际环境中高效运行。
10. 最佳实践与配置
本手册涵盖模型命名规范、结构组织以及配置技巧,帮助用户遵循最佳实践,提升项目效率。
掌握这些功能后,用户将能够充分利用PowerDesigner 15实现高效的数据管理和系统开发。
Sybase
0
2024-10-28
如何使用sp_configure更改Sybase12.5参数值
Sp_configure 改变参数值是 Sybase 12.5 中常见的操作。使用 sp_configure 命令可以更改配置参数的值,具体语法如下:
语法: sp_configure 'parameter_name', parameter_value
示例: sp_configure 'number of remote connections', 50
当执行此命令时,系统会提示: Configuration option changed. Since the option is static, Adaptive Server must be rebooted in order for the change to take effect. 这表示该配置项是静态的,需要重启 Adaptive Server 才能生效。
Sybase
0
2024-10-27
PowerDesigner数据库设计工具详解
PowerDesigner数据库设计工具 是一款功能强大的数据库建模工具,广泛应用于IT行业,尤其在数据库设计阶段。它由Sybase公司开发,提供了概念数据模型(CDM)、逻辑数据模型(LDM)和物理数据模型(PDM)三种主要的建模功能。其核心功能包括:
模型创建与管理:用户可以通过PowerDesigner创建多种数据模型,定义实体、属性、关系,并且支持版本控制以便团队协作。
数据流建模:支持过程或系统级别的建模,包括数据流图(DFD),帮助用户理解业务流程中的数据流动。
物理数据库生成:根据逻辑模型,PowerDesigner可以生成适合不同数据库管理系统(如Oracle、MySQL、SQL Server)的物理数据库脚本。
性能优化:分析物理数据模型中的表和索引布局,提供优化建议以提升查询性能。
逆向工程:从现有数据库导入结构生成模型,帮助用户理解已有系统的数据库结构。
文档生成:自动生成模型报告和数据库文档,方便团队交流与项目文档化。
合规性检查:提供模型检查功能,确保符合不同行业标准,如ORM和UML。
使用步骤
启动与安装:运行powerdesigner125_eval.exe安装程序,完成安装。
新建模型:选择新建模型类型,如概念数据模型或物理数据模型。
设计模型:在模型工作区中添加实体、属性和关系,设置属性类型和约束。
转换模型:将概念模型转化为逻辑模型,再转化为物理模型。
生成数据库脚本:在物理模型基础上生成适合目标数据库的脚本。
Sybase
0
2024-10-26
PowerDesigner16.5 pdflm16.dll 破解文件说明
PowerDesigner 16.5 评估版提供了15天的试用期限。本资源包含破解文件 pdflm16.dll,适用于 PowerDesigner 16.5 版本。PowerDesigner 是一款非常优秀的CASE工具,推荐有条件的朋友使用正版软件,以获得最佳支持与更新体验。
Sybase
0
2024-10-26
程序员速成指南SYBASE_DBA移植步骤详解
移植步骤
前期准备
移植工作量初步评估:评估预期移植范围及可能的资源需求。
制定移植计划:明确时间表、资源分配、人员安排,确保项目顺利推进。
前期技术培训:对相关人员进行SYBASE技术培训,确保团队具备移植所需技能。
安装移植开发环境:部署并配置SYBASE环境,确保技术和硬件满足移植需求。
移植执行
移植数据结构:检查现有数据库表结构,调整适配SYBASE环境。
移植数据:迁移现有数据,确保数据完整性及一致性。
移植应用:包括存储过程、SQL语句及客户端程序的移植,调整逻辑以适配SYBASE。
后期优化
系统测试:进行功能、性能、兼容性测试,确保系统稳定。
系统调优:分析性能瓶颈,优化查询及系统设置。
维护管理:建立维护流程,确保移植系统的长期可靠性和可扩展性。
移植步骤
完整的移植流程从前期准备到后期维护,确保数据库环境顺利迁移至SYBASE平台。
Sybase
0
2024-10-26
PowerDesigner 16.0破解版分卷压缩下载与安装指南
PowerDesigner是由Sybase提供的企业建模和设计解决方案。此软件采用模型驱动的方法,将业务与IT结合在一起,帮助企业构建高效的体系架构。PowerDesigner 16.0破解版支持多达60多种数据库系统(RDBMS)/版本,为企业提供强大的分析和设计技术。当前版本为16.0,分卷压缩包共19卷,此为第4卷下载资源。
Sybase
0
2024-10-25
VB企业人事管理系统设计与应用
【VB企业人事管理系统】是一款简易企业管理软件,专为学生期末考试设计,涵盖人事管理的基础功能,帮助学生更好地理解和学习。该系统利用Visual Basic(VB)开发,结合其易用性和强大的编程功能,提供了操作简单、界面直观的用户体验,使学生能够快速掌握人事管理的基本流程。VB企业人事管理系统的核心模块包括:
员工信息管理:支持员工的基本信息录入、查询、修改与删除,涵盖姓名、性别、年龄、部门和职位等信息,并通过数据库有效存储和检索。
考勤管理:记录员工出勤情况,如迟到、早退、请假和加班,为薪资计算提供有效依据。
薪资福利管理:涵盖工资、奖金与福利等财务信息,系统自动计算基础工资和绩效奖金等,简化了人力资源部门的操作。
培训与发展:记录员工培训、技能评估及职业发展规划,支持员工成长与人才培养。
绩效考核:提供业绩评估标准,帮助管理者公平地进行绩效打分。
报表生成:自动生成如员工花名册、考勤统计、薪资汇总等多种人事统计报表,为决策提供数据支持。
权限管理:基于职务设置不同权限,保障数据安全。
用户界面:VB的图形用户界面使得操作直观,便于非专业人员使用。
通过开发和实践该系统,学生不仅掌握了VB编程和面向对象编程概念,还能学习数据库设计、用户交互设计等知识,并增强对企业管理的实际理解,尤其在人力资源管理方面。【VB企业人事管理】是结合理论与实践的优质教学案例,有助于提升学生综合素质。
Sybase
0
2024-10-25
DataModelViewer在Mac下轻松查看PDM文件的高效工具
《DataModelViewer:mac系统下的PDM文件查看利器》
在信息技术领域,数据模型是数据库设计的核心,它清晰地描绘了数据的结构、关系以及业务规则。PDM(Physical Data Model)作为数据模型的一种,主要关注数据库的实际物理实现。对于开发人员和DBA来说,能够有效地查看和理解PDM文件至关重要。在mac操作系统环境下,DataModelViewer是一款专为查看PDM文件而设计的强大工具。我们来了解什么是PDM。PDM,即物理数据模型,是在逻辑数据模型的基础上,考虑了数据库管理系统(DBMS)的特性,如表空间、索引、分区等实际存储和性能因素后构建的。
DataModelViewer的核心功能包括:
图形化展示:DataModelViewer能够将复杂的PDM文件以直观的图表形式展示,使得用户可以一目了然地看到实体间的关系,便于理解和分析数据模型。
详细信息查看:对于每个实体、属性和关系,DataModelViewer都提供了详细的属性信息,包括数据类型、长度、约束条件等,帮助用户深入理解每个元素的特性。
搜索与导航:通过内置的搜索功能,用户可以快速定位到特定的实体或属性,同时,导航功能使得在大型数据模型中移动变得轻松便捷。
导出与打印:DataModelViewer支持将数据模型导出为各种格式,如图片、PDF等,方便分享和存档。同时,还可以打印模型,便于在会议或讨论中进行展示。
兼容性:此工具通常能兼容多种PDM文件格式,如ERWin、PowerDesigner、Oracle SQL Developer等主流数据建模工具产生的文件,确保了跨平台和工具间的协作。
使用DataModelViewer.app,用户无需安装复杂的数据库设计软件,就能在mac系统上轻松查看和理解PDM文件。这对于数据库管理员、开发人员以及项目管理人员来说,无疑提升了工作效率,简化了工作流程。
在实际应用中,DataModelViewer可以广泛应用于数据库设计的评审、项目合作、数据库优化等场景。通过它,团队成员可以共同查看和讨论数据模型。
Sybase
0
2024-10-25